Raw Broccoli has 41.2 calories per serving (1 Small Cup). It provides 2.8g protein, 6.6g carbs, and 0.4g fat. With a low glycemic index (GI: 44), this recipe is suitable for weight loss, diabetes management, heart health and more. The 2.6g of dietary fiber per serving adds to its nutritional value.

At just 41.2 kcal per serving, this is an excellent choice for weight management.
With a low glycemic index of 44, this recipe supports stable blood sugar levels. The 2.6g fiber further slows glucose absorption.
Low protein content (2.8g per serving) — not sufficient alone for muscle building. Combine with high-protein sides like paneer, eggs, chicken, dal, or a protein shake to reach 25-30g protein per meal.
Zero cholesterol and low saturated fat (0.1g) make this heart-friendly. Low sodium content is ideal for blood pressure management.
Low GI (44) with 2.6g fiber supports insulin sensitivity — key for PCOS management. The high fiber content supports hormone balance by aiding estrogen metabolism.
Contains cruciferous vegetables which are goitrogenic when raw. However, cooking significantly reduces goitrogen activity. If you have hypothyroidism, ensure these are well-cooked and maintain a gap of 30-60 minutes from thyroid medication.
